引言
随着信息技术的飞速发展,大数据已经成为推动社会进步的重要力量。掌握大数据的核心技能,对于个人职业发展和企业竞争力提升都具有重要意义。本文将为您揭秘大数据入门必修课,帮助您轻松掌握核心技能,开启数据驱动未来之旅。
一、大数据概述
1.1 大数据定义
大数据是指规模巨大、类型繁多、价值密度低的数据集合。它具有4V特点:Volume(大量)、Velocity(高速)、Variety(多样)和Value(价值)。
1.2 大数据应用领域
大数据在各个领域都有广泛应用,如金融、医疗、教育、交通、互联网等。
二、大数据入门必修技能
2.1 编程语言
2.1.1 Python
Python是一种广泛应用于大数据领域的编程语言,具有简洁、易学、易用等特点。掌握Python是大数据入门的基础。
2.1.2 Java
Java是一种面向对象的编程语言,在大数据处理领域具有广泛的应用。学习Java有助于深入了解大数据生态系统。
2.2 数据库技术
2.2.1 关系型数据库
关系型数据库如MySQL、Oracle等,是存储和管理大数据的重要工具。
2.2.2 非关系型数据库
非关系型数据库如MongoDB、Redis等,适用于存储结构化、半结构化和非结构化数据。
2.3 大数据技术栈
2.3.1 Hadoop
Hadoop是一个开源的大数据处理框架,适用于处理海量数据。
2.3.2 Spark
Spark是一个快速、通用的大数据处理引擎,适用于批处理、流处理和交互式查询。
2.3.3 Flink
Flink是一个流处理框架,适用于实时数据处理。
2.4 数据可视化
数据可视化是将数据以图形、图表等形式展示出来的过程,有助于发现数据中的规律和趋势。
2.5 数据挖掘与机器学习
数据挖掘和机器学习是大数据分析的核心技术,可以帮助我们从海量数据中提取有价值的信息。
三、大数据学习资源
3.1 在线课程
- Coursera:提供大数据、机器学习等领域的在线课程。
- Udemy:提供丰富的编程、数据分析等课程。
- edX:由哈佛大学和麻省理工学院联合创办,提供高质量的课程。
3.2 书籍
- 《大数据时代》
- 《Hadoop实战》
- 《机器学习实战》
3.3 社区与论坛
- CSDN
- Stack Overflow
- GitHub
四、总结
大数据作为一门新兴技术,具有广泛的应用前景。通过学习大数据入门必修课,我们可以轻松掌握核心技能,开启数据驱动未来之旅。希望本文能对您有所帮助。
